B.3
Calibrating the analog output
The analog output is calibrated at the factory to the values shown in Table B-2.
To comply with plant standards, it may be necessary to adjust the AO calibration points.
To adjust the AO calibration points:
1. Attach a meter to the analog output.
2. Select
Configure > I/O > AO Points
.
3. Ensure that Scanning is enabled.
4. To calibrate the output at 4 mA:
a.
In the General panel, set the
Value
parameter to
0
.
b.
In the Advanced panel, modify the
Adjusted D/A 0%
value until the meter reads
4 mA
.
c.
Click
Apply
.
5. To calibrate the output at 20 mA:
a.
In the General panel, set the
Value
parameter to
100
.
b.
In the Advanced panel, modify the
Adjusted D/A 100%
value until the meter reads
20 mA
.
c.
Click
Apply
.

B.4
Density calibration
The Model 3711 system is factory-calibrated for density and does not normally need to be calibrated
in the field. Calibrate the transmitter only if you must do so to meet regulatory requirements.
Note: Micro Motion recommends using meter factors, rather than calibration, to prove the meter
against a regulatory standard or to correct measurement error. Contact Micro Motion before
calibrating your Model 3711 system. For information on meter factors, see Section 5.5.3.
B.4.1
Preparing for calibration
Density calibration includes the following calibration points:
•
D1 calibration (low-density)
•
D2 calibration (high-density)
D1 and D2 density calibration require a D1 (low-density) fluid and a D2 (high-density) fluid. You
may use air and water.
Both calibrations must be performed without interruption, in the order shown in Figure B-5.
